2014-04-01 72 views
2

我試圖生成我的項目文檔包java.lang中,並得到了一個錯誤上的java.lang的Android的javadoc,com.sun.tools.javac.util.FatalError:致命錯誤:無法找到在類路徑或引導類路徑

Loading source files for package com.swimtechtest.swimmer... 
Loading source files for package com.swimtechtest.swimmer.math... 
Loading source files for package com.swimtechtest.swimmer.database... 
Loading source files for package com.swimtechtest.swimmer.helpers... 
Constructing Javadoc information... 
com.sun.tools.javac.util.FatalError: Fatal Error: Unable to find package java.lang in classpath or bootclasspath 
at com.sun.tools.javac.comp.MemberEnter.importAll(MemberEnter.java:123) 
at com.sun.tools.javac.comp.MemberEnter.visitTopLevel(MemberEnter.java:509) 
at com.sun.tools.javac.tree.JCTree$JCCompilationUnit.accept(JCTree.java:446) 
at com.sun.tools.javac.comp.MemberEnter.memberEnter(MemberEnter.java:387) 
at com.sun.tools.javac.comp.MemberEnter.complete(MemberEnter.java:819) 
at com.sun.tools.javac.code.Symbol.complete(Symbol.java:384) 
at com.sun.tools.javac.code.Symbol$ClassSymbol.complete(Symbol.java:766) 
at com.sun.tools.javac.comp.Enter.complete(Enter.java:464) 
at com.sun.tools.javac.comp.Enter.main(Enter.java:442) 
at com.sun.tools.javadoc.JavadocEnter.main(JavadocEnter.java:53) 
at com.sun.tools.javadoc.JavadocTool.getRootDocImpl(JavadocTool.java:152) 
at com.sun.tools.javadoc.Start.parseAndExecute(Start.java:330) 
at com.sun.tools.javadoc.Start.begin(Start.java:128) 
at com.sun.tools.javadoc.Main.execute(Main.java:41) 
at com.sun.tools.javadoc.Main.main(Main.java:31) 
javadoc: error - fatal error 
1 error 
+0

可能重複[FatalError而創建的javadoc(無法找到包java.lang中)](http://stackoverflow.com/questions/20272715/fatalerror-while-creating- Javadoc的無法找到的包的Java琅) –

回答

0

這爲我工作:

1)從路徑中刪除空格的android.jar(所有我試過的修復,使其能夠用空格爲我工作沒工作)

2)選擇項目/生成Javadoc ...

3)輸入正確的路徑javadoc的可執行文件,這在我的情況是這樣的:

enter image description here

4)單擊下一步,輸入文檔標題

5)單擊下一步,並添加引導類路徑到VM選項。我在我的Mac上搜索了一下android.jar。確保你使用了正確的位置和版本。煤礦是這樣的:

enter image description here

6)點擊完成,它應該工作。

希望幫助:-)的